What to Eat
There are many great places to eat in Châteaufneuf-du-Faou and Le Faouët. Here are a few of the most popular dishes:
- Crêpes: Crêpes are a thin pancake that can be filled with a variety of ingredients, both sweet and savory.
- Galettes: Galettes are a type of buckwheat pancake that is typically filled with savory ingredients.
- Kouign-amann: Kouign-amann is a buttery, flaky pastry that is a specialty of Brittany.
